What Causes Vaginal Bleeding After A Multifetal Pregnancy Reduction Procedure?
I had fetal reduction from triplets to singleton almost a month ago. It went well, the ultrasound a week later showed the healthy baby was still alive and growing. I don t have an appointment for ultrasound for the anatomy scan for a couple days, and I have contacted the hospital that gave me my reduction and left a message.. but I am experiencing some blood loss. Most of it seems to be old blood, coming out brown... mostly when I m active... Usually only a little bit.. but when I stand for too long I end up losing what looks like mucous and sometimes red blood when I have bowel movements. Is this normal. The last 2 days I ve lost clots roughly the size of a quarter. Only 2 so far that I ve noticed... Is that probably just the identical pair bleeding out finally ? I m not experiencing pain, so I m not sure if it s a miscarriage

Fetal loss after post-reduction procedure in multifetal pregnancy is possible
But in your case the remaining fetus was found to be growing to help it grow you should take rest, good nutrition &follow the instructions are given.
Stress might be the cause of the bleeding (likely to be from the extinct fetuses.
Though red blood &mucus is a bit alarming).. you should not lose courage.
Continue with all the care advised & consult your treating doctor for needful hormone replacement.
